The evolution of the Internet of Things (IoT) has begun to revolutionize varied industries, and one of the areas experiencing significant transformation is building automation methods. The integration of IoT connectivity into these methods is enhancing effectivity, lowering energy consumption, and bettering overall user experience. Building automation encompasses the management and control of varied methods such as lighting, heating, air flow, air-con, safety, and heaps of others.


IoT connectivity in building automation methods offers real-time monitoring and control capabilities that were not potential before. Through the utilization of sensors and gadgets linked to the web, constructing managers can entry data on environmental circumstances, occupancy ranges, and energy utilization, facilitating informed decision-making. This connectivity allows for the automation of tasks that had been once manual, enabling a smarter and extra responsive environment.


In the previous, constructing automation methods typically functioned in silos. Each system, whether it was HVAC, lighting, or security, operated independently, leading to inefficiencies and increased operational prices. The creation of IoT connectivity permits for a extra integrated approach. Through interconnected systems, info can be shared across varied platforms, resulting in higher efficiencies and streamlined operations.


For example, when a building's occupancy sensor detects that a room is unoccupied, it can sign the HVAC system to scale back energy utilization by adjusting the temperature accordingly. Simultaneously, the lighting system can dim or flip off lights in that room. This level of coordination impacts energy savings significantly, resulting in a discount in operational costs and a minimized carbon footprint.

Moreover, the power to watch systems remotely by way of IoT connectivity allows predictive maintenance. Building managers can receive alerts when systems are functioning exterior of regular parameters. This allows for well timed interventions earlier than minor issues escalate into pricey repairs. This proactive method not solely extends the lifespan of equipment but also enhances the safety of the environment for its occupants.


Incorporating IoT into constructing automation methods also improves person experiences. Tenants in business and residential buildings more and more anticipate personalized, responsive environments. By enabling consumer control by way of mobile functions or web interfaces, occupants can customize their settings for lighting, temperature, and other environmental components primarily based on their preferences. This personalization significantly enhances comfort, resulting in greater tenant satisfaction and retention.

Another noteworthy side is the potential for enhanced security by way of IoT-enabled constructing automation systems. Surveillance cameras, door entry controls, and alarm systems could be built-in, offering comprehensive real-time monitoring and alerts. This connectivity allows security personnel to reply swiftly to situations, making certain the protection of building occupants. Energy efficiency is amongst the most cited advantages of IoT connectivity in constructing automation. As city areas turn out to be more and more crowded, the need for sustainable solutions becomes paramount. IoT technology enables buildings to adapt to energy demands dynamically. For occasion, buildings can shift energy utilization to off-peak hours, using smart grids and collaborating in demand-response packages.


This shift not only reduces energy prices for constructing homeowners but in addition contributes to the steadiness of the electrical grid. Smart technologies also play an important role in complying with evolving constructing laws and sustainability standards. Efficiency metrics can be captured and analyzed, demonstrating adherence to guidelines and doubtlessly qualifying for green constructing certifications.

Integration with renewable energy sources is one other space where IoT connectivity shines. Buildings equipped with photo voltaic panels or other renewable technologies can leverage IoT methods to optimize energy consumption and storage. By monitoring energy production and utilization in over at this website real-time, building managers can make knowledgeable choices about when to attract from the grid and when to make the most of stored energy. This interconnectedness fosters a shift toward not solely energy-efficient buildings but in addition self-sustaining energy ecosystems.


As organizations contemplate the implementation of IoT connectivity, it's essential to deal with the cybersecurity elements. With elevated connectivity comes elevated vulnerability. Therefore, it is essential to put cash into strong security measures to guard against cyber threats. This entails implementing secure communication protocols and repeatedly monitoring methods for potential vulnerabilities.

Building managers should take a proactive stance in educating themselves and their teams about finest practices in cybersecurity. Regular updates, audits, and training can go a good distance in mitigating dangers related to IoT connectivity in building automation techniques.


Additionally, knowledge privateness is a critical consideration. Automating techniques and collecting data can result in concerns about how this data is used and who has access to it. Establishing clear knowledge governance practices and complying with rules can construct trust with occupants and stakeholders.

The future of constructing automation systems will inevitably be intertwined with developments in IoT expertise. As extra devices turn out to be smart and linked, their capabilities will continue to grow. Potential functions could include machine learning algorithms assessing occupancy patterns to recommend optimized energy methods or automated techniques that adapt dynamically to occupant behavior.


In conclusion, IoT connectivity in building automation methods represents a major leap towards smarter, more environment friendly, and responsive environments. The integration fosters energy efficiency, enhances security, streamlines operations, and improves consumer experiences. As buildings turn into more and more sophisticated, both house owners and occupants will understand the advantages of interconnected systems. Nevertheless, considerations surrounding cybersecurity and knowledge privacy remain essential in totally harnessing the potential of IoT in constructing automation. The journey in direction of a fully connected, automated future is rife with opportunities, essentially reworking the way we take into consideration constructing management and person consolation.
